‘I’m done with Canada’: High cost of living leads some to leave the country

With the Bank of Canada’s recent decision to raise its key interest rate, and the average price of a home rising year-over-year, many Canadians say they are struggling to afford housing. As a result, some have decided to relocate to countries where they will pay less for accommodation and other essential items.

One of those people is Roland Cameron from Hamilton, Ont. Cameron and his wife arrived in Barbados on July 10 and plan to live there permanently. The couple had considered living in other countries before settling on Barbados, where Cameron’s father’s side of the family lives. In search of a lower cost of living, the couple hopes to make the value of their dollar go further, Cameron said.
